WebMay 17, 2011 · The barrel can get it done, for sure. I try to feed it 75gr Hornady or 77gr SMK mostly, but it still does good with 68/69gr ammo, too. 62gr M855 is decent, but nowhere near the others listed before. 55gr PMC Bronze is usually good, but sucks through this barrel after 300. All Yankee Hill Machine Gun Parts Reviews All Gun Parts Reviews All Yankee Hill … timo weber adessoWebDec 24, 2003 · I ordered a barrel from a custom barrel maker that had a sale a few years ago. It was chambered for the 300/221. I had several problems like Pachmyer adapter wouldn't fit on it right, flat spring that would hold pressure on the extractor would keep backing out, and it wouldn't shoot like a "custom" barrel should.
